#fc9c67 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#fc9c67 is composed of 98.8% red, 61.2% green and 40.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 38.1% magenta, 59.1% yellow and 1.2% black. It has a hue angle of 21.3 degrees, a saturation of 96.1% and a lightness of 69.6%. #fc9c67 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ffce with #f93900. Closest websafe color is: #ff9966.

Shades and Tints of #fc9c67

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020100 is the darkest color, while #fff4ee is the lightest one.

Tones of #fc9c67

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#b4b1af is the less saturated color, while #fc9c67 is the most saturated one.
